    It's best to make your own nozzles, a good way is to scan things like small leaves and build a nozzle. Nozzles can get quite complex with 3 ranks, however nearly every nozzle I've ever seen has just been a simple one rank nozzle.

    The simple steps are first assemble your object one different layers, have the background transparent. Then select all the layers and group them using the group layer command at the bottom of the layers palette (on the left)

    Then go to the nozzles in the toolbox and you will see a dropdown menu there to "make nozzle from group", do that. Then save it and that's your nozzle.

    To use it you go to the same nozzle menu in the toolbox and select "load nozzle" Get your nozzle brush and start spraying.

    You'll find information about using Corel Painter's Nozzles and creating Nozzles and Nozzle libraries in the following chapter:

    Painter IX Help > Help Topics > Contents tab > Image Hose


    There are free and for-purchase Nozzles as well as tutorials available on the following sites:

    DigArts Software

    Rapartz

    Also, if you do a Google search using the words Painter Nozzles, you'll find several pages full of links to free Nozzle downloads and tutorials.
